Construction Industries (CI) is one of three primary segments of Caterpillar (Construction Industries, Resources Industries and Power & Energy) and is comprised of seven divisions. Collectively, the teams across the segment are responsible for business strategy, product design and development, manufacturing, supply management, marketing and sales, and product support.

The product portfolio includes asphalt pavers, backhoe loaders, cold planers, compactors, compact track loaders, forestry machines, material handlers, motor graders, pipelayers, road reclaimers, skid steer loaders, telehandlers, track-type loaders, track-type tractors (small, medium), track excavators (mini, small, medium, large), wheel excavators, wheel loaders (compact, small, medium), and related parts and work tools.

The Communications Specialist – Construction Industries (CI) Process Excellence supports the design, development, production and consultation on various internal and external communications processes, materials and media. The role partners closely with the CI communications team supporting commercial divisions as well as cross-functional experts to shape messaging and drive alignment that advance the organization's business objectives.

This position will report to the communications manager for CI Process Excellence and will create employee communications content and participate in the planning and execution of communications initiatives across the commercial teams and the segment.

What You Will Do:

· Collaborate with subject matter experts, business leaders, legal, media relations and communications colleagues to develop content for internal and external audiences, including success stories, announcements, large events, presentations, speeches and articles

· Apply Lean principles and process excellence to enhance quality and accelerate delivery, ensuring streamlined, high-impact communications.

· Embrace technology and innovation to reach and engage audiences in new and creative ways

· Translate complex concepts into clear, audience-appropriate communications for internal and external stakeholders

· Uphold brand standards by maintaining a consistent tone and style across all content, adhering to brand guidelines and voice

· Analyze performance, monitor communications metrics to refine strategies and continuously improve engagement

· Collaborating with internal stakeholders and advising on the suitability of approaches for communication efforts.
